The Blue Marble National Geographic Pottery Wheel Kit is a comprehensive beginner-friendly pottery set featuring a durable 2-speed AC motor wheel, 2 lbs. of air dry clay, innovative arm tools for easy shaping, and a full suite of sculpting and painting accessories. Designed for kids and novices, it includes detailed instructions and video lessons to foster creativity and learning without the need for firing or baking. This Amazon exclusive kit combines hands-on STEM education with artistic expression, making it a top-rated, reliable choice for young creators.

Tried this out with 9 year old daughter and took a few tries to get a decent result. Like other reviewers, getting the clay to stick to the platform is key. I even went so far as to mush the heck out of it to the surface so it was as stuck as can be. The clay it comes with isn't very fresh, so that doesn't help one bit. I'm sure this would be an overall much easier experience if you buy some fresh clay. Clay really needs an adult to knead it and you should definitely add water to get it the right consistency so it doesn't just crack apart when turning it. Aside from that, easy to use, directions are decent, assembly a snap. Great gift overall.

The air dry clay that comes with the kit is difficult to use on the wheel. Recommend using actual clay and then the results are more to expectations. Fun for school to introduce students to the wheel. Easy to pack and transport, good video tutorials to watch.
